| OLD | NEW |
| 1 <html> | 1 <html> |
| 2 <body> | 2 <body> |
| 3 <script> | 3 <script> |
| 4 if (window.testRunner) { | 4 if (window.testRunner) { |
| 5 testRunner.waitUntilDone(); | 5 testRunner.waitUntilDone(); |
| 6 testRunner.dumpAsText(); | 6 testRunner.dumpAsText(); |
| 7 testRunner.dumpFrameLoadCallbacks(); | 7 testRunner.dumpFrameLoadCallbacks(); |
| 8 testRunner.setCanOpenWindows(); | 8 testRunner.setCanOpenWindows(); |
| 9 testRunner.setCloseRemainingWindowsWhenComplete(true); | 9 testRunner.setCloseRemainingWindowsWhenComplete(true); |
| 10 testRunner.overridePreference("WebKitAllowRunningInsecureContent", false); | 10 testRunner.overridePreference("WebKitAllowRunningInsecureContent", false); |
| 11 testRunner.setAllowRunningOfInsecureContent(true); | 11 testRunner.setAllowRunningOfInsecureContent(true); |
| 12 } | 12 } |
| 13 | 13 |
| 14 window.addEventListener("message", function (e) { | 14 window.addEventListener("message", function (e) { |
| 15 if (window.testRunner) | 15 if (window.testRunner) |
| 16 testRunner.notifyDone(); | 16 testRunner.notifyDone(); |
| 17 }, false); | 17 }, false); |
| 18 | 18 |
| 19 </script> | 19 </script> |
| 20 <p>This test opens a window that loads an insecure script. We should trigger | 20 <p>This test opens a window that loads an insecure script. We should trigger |
| 21 a mixed content callback even though we've set the preference to block this, | 21 a mixed content callback even though we've set the preference to block this, |
| 22 because we've overriden the preference via a web permission client callback.</p> | 22 because we've overriden the preference via a web permission client callback.</p> |
| 23 <script> | 23 <script> |
| 24 window.open("https://127.0.0.1:8443/security/mixedContent/resources/frame-with-i
nsecure-script.html"); | 24 window.open("https://127.0.0.1:8443/security/mixedContent/resources/frame-with-i
nsecure-script.html"); |
| 25 </script> | 25 </script> |
| 26 </body> | 26 </body> |
| 27 </html> | 27 </html> |
| OLD | NEW |